About Mecklenburg County, Virginia

Mecklenburg County, Virginia has a total population of 30,516, making it the 1,464th most populous county in the United States. The median age in Mecklenburg County is 49.2 years, which is 26.5% above the national median of 38.9 years.

The median household income in Mecklenburg County is $57,045, which ranks #2,326 of 3,222 counties nationwide. This is 24.1% below the national median of $75,149. The poverty rate is 16.3%, higher than the national rate of 12.6%. The unemployment rate stands at 2.6%.

The median home value in Mecklenburg County is $192,600, 31.7% below the national median. Renters in Mecklenburg County pay a median gross rent of $823 per month. The homeownership rate is 68.3%, compared to the national rate of 64.4%.

In Mecklenburg County, 20.7%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her, 38.6% below the national average of 33.7%. Health insurance coverage stands at 94.2% of the population. The average commute time for workers is 28.1 min.

Mecklenburg County is a diverse community. The largest racial or ethnic group is White (non-Hispanic) at 60.3% of the population, followed by Black (non-Hispanic) (32.4%) and Hispanic or Latino (3.2%).

All data for Mecklenburg County, Virginia comes from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ates.
